DescriptionHVAIKT18Label Text2005-02-26: Thota Vaikuntam (b. 1942) Two Women 1987 Graphite under-drawing with ink wash and watercolor on laminated paperboard Gift from the Chester and Davida Herwitz Collection, 2002.512 Similar, yet different, these women-perhaps a mother and her daughter-wear bindis, nose- and ear-studs, rigid chokers (hasli) and hair buns. Their chins are decorated with tribal chin tattoos.
